I contacted a company down in Florida that manufactures the dash kits, and the wire harnesses for all vehicles Metra and was told that the rds system in the s-10 does not hook up to the computer as the true rds does. It appears to me that GM uses the rds radio but not the hook up. I bought my kits right thru them and hooked up my system with no probs. Heres the number, call them yourself to be at ease.
